Contrast audit scope: all Brindlet UI surfaces, WCAG AA targets. Tooling: the Huemark scanner, nightly, results in the audit vault. Security-relevant: scanner runs with read-only production snapshots; verify no token leakage in screenshots. Findings are signed before storage. To verify signatures or reopen a sealed finding, unlock the audit keystore with the recovery passphrase below.

unlock words, yawig-kagef: gordor-holvan-ulaael-pramir-ulaiel-tamdor

Internal Memo — Leased Laptop Returns, Corvane Leasing

All forty leased laptops have been wiped, tagged, and palletised in the east storeroom for return to Corvane Leasing's depot at Millbrook. The coordinator must ensure the pallet stays shrink-wrapped until collection and the manifest travels with the driver. The courier's hand-over instruction is stated below.

drop instructions, yafog-yawip: the quenmir olidor courier leaves the julox tamion keliel ledger at gate 5283 under passcode 336825

Quarterly Planning Note — Divestiture of the Coastal Tooling Unit

For the finance team: the sale of the Coastal Tooling unit to Pellmark Industries remains on track for close in Q3. Please finalize the carve-out balance sheet, reconcile intercompany positions, and prepare the working-capital adjustment schedule by month-end. Audit support requests should be prioritized. For planning purposes, note the following sensitive item:

internal memo for hawef-kahif: The finance team signed off on a budget of $25.9 million for Project Sorox. The renewal with Pelokek Logistics closes at $51.7 million a year, 52 percent below the last contract.